Local Housing Facts for Churdan

  • ·Median home value: $157,652 (adjusted for current market conditions)
  • ·Est. property taxes: $1,382/yr — pre-loaded from county assessment data
  • ·Homeowners insurance (HO-3): $807/yr — based on local per-$1K premium rates
  • ·Energy utilities: $5,654/yr — sourced from DOE LEAD survey data
  • ·Flood insurance: optional — toggled off by default, estimate based on FEMA risk profile

What is the true total cost of owning a home in Churdan?

True homeownership costs go beyond principal and interest. In Churdan, a typical homeowner with a median-priced home of $157,652 can expect to pay roughly $1,382/yr in property taxes, $807/yr for homeowners insurance, and $5,654/yr in energy utilities. That adds approximately $654 per month in ongoing costs on top of your mortgage payment. Use our calculator above to model your exact all-in monthly cost.
